Вот скриншот из приложения, которое у меня есть в podio. Я пытаюсь установить адресное поле с помощью скрипта php. Ниже показано, как я настраиваю свои поля.

$field->values = array(
        'value' => $latLong['address'],
        'lat' => $latLong['latitude'],
        'lng' => $latLong['longitude']
    );

Из ленты активности элемента видно, что адрес был обновлен. Но когда вы смотрите на фактический элемент, местоположение адреса остается пустым, но у него правильное местоположение на карте. Есть идеи о том, что вызывает эту проблему?

Screenshot

0
Onome Omene 21 Ноя 2018 в 00:07

1 ответ

Лучший ответ

Попробуйте установить значение немного по-другому :)

  addr_full = { 'street_address'  => 'some street address here',
                'postal_code'     => 'some zip code, eg: 90210',
                'city'            => 'Beverly Hills',
                'state'           => 'CA',
                'country'         => 'United States' }

Извините, код взят из Ruby, но преобразовать его в синтаксис php не составит труда.

1
Pavlo - Podio 26 Ноя 2018 в 12:07